    Curious as to what peoples preferred race day rituals are for food.. from breakfast to during and after..maybe even night before..

    This is a huge topic but I'll do a quick summary. In general, the day before I would eat little over salted food, sometimes it would be some pasta and sometimes even a steak (more relaxed :P ). In the morning of the race I prefer some fruit and then eggs with olive oil and crushed almonds and during the race I have different "receipt" from my coach (mostly carbs with a bit of proteins, salt and l-carnitine but it depends on the weather/distance/goal). After the race I take some fruit and preferably soup (Lough Cutra Triathlon had fantastic beans and quinoa soup). Later in the day I would probably eat some extra proteins, chicken or similar...

    Nothing too different from normal to be honest. Night before some pasta and chicken, probably what I have most Friday nights anyway. Probably have porridge for breakfast and then depending on the start time a small lunch, for Carlow I brought along some ham sandwiches and had them around 1.5hrs before the race started. During the race had some jellies. Find this works better for me than a big change, keep it to what you know and what you know works well for your.

    porridge or weetabix and muesli pre race. fluids leading up to the race. 1 gel early on the bike, and another somewhere around t2.

    something with sugar directly afterwards, drink or food, and then normal food for the rest of the day
